How these records are matched
A conservative grouping of federal contribution rows with this exact filed name and five-digit ZIP. ZIP+4 extensions are retained as evidence but ignored for matching. This is a reported identity cluster, not yet a verified person-level entity.

Source & identity status
Trace every claim back to the public record
The FEC publishes names and addresses as reported, but does not assign a persistent ID to each individual contributor. GovMoneyGraph links variants here only when employer and location or occupation evidence corroborates compatible names; conflicting middle initials remain separate. These heuristic clusters stay reviewable until promoted into the persistent entity graph through the labeled gold-set process.
